Understanding Asset Tags and Tagging in Kenya
In Kenya, organized asset tracking read more is growing increasingly important for companies of all scales. Equipment markers are small labels, usually made from long-lasting materials like plastic, affixed to movable assets to support their location. This method, known as asset tagging, goes deeper than simply sticking a label. It requires a organized system for maintaining asset information – including data like serial numbers, acquisition dates, and service intervals. Accurate tagging enables for improved record keeping, lowers theft, facilitates assessments, and finally boosts resource utilization. Consider using RFID tags for even greater asset security.

Finding the Ideal Asset Tracking Program in Kenya
Successfully overseeing assets in Kenya's unique business landscape demands more than just rudimentary labeling. Picking the correct asset identification system is essential for ensuring ownership and reducing theft . Several options are accessible, from conventional paper-based approaches to modern RFID and barcode technologies. Consider factors such as the organization's resources, the volume of assets to be managed, the conditions they exist in (e.g., tough industrial sites ), and the degree of linking needed with current software . In conclusion, a comprehensive assessment of your unique needs will lead you to the best equipment tagging solution .
